- The distance between Rasht, Iran and Haeju, South Korea is approximately 6,493 km or 4,035 mi.
- To reach Rasht in this distance one would set out from Haeju bearing 295° or WNW and follow the great circles arc to approach Rasht bearing 243.9° or WSW .
- Rasht has a Mediterranean hot climate (Csa) whereas Haeju has a hot summer continental climate with dry winters (Dwa).
- Rasht is in or near the subtropical moist forest biome whereas Haeju is in or near the cool temperate moist forest biome.
- The annual mean temperature is 5.8 °C (10.4°F) warmer.
- Average monthly temperatures vary by 10 °C (18°F) less in Rasht. The continentality subtype is semicontinental as opposed to truly continental.
- Total annual precipitation averages 208 mm (8.2 in) more which is equivalent to 208 l/m² (5.1 US gal/ft²) or 2,080,000 l/ha (222,366 US gal/ac) more. About 1 1/6 as much.
- The altitude of the sun at midday is overall 0.7° higher in Rasht than in Haeju.
